特定の拡張子のファイルが複数あるフォルダ内で、固定ファイルの中身をランダムに入れ替えるアプリです。
例えばmp3ファイルがたくさん入っているフォルダを指定して、拡張子にmp3を指定してスイッチを入れたとします。
すると指定フォルダ内のmp3ファイルから無作為に1つを選択してコピーし、ユーザーメモリ直下に「Randomized」フォルダを作成し、「randomized.mp3」という名前で保存します(変更可能)。この処理は1日1回深夜0時くらいに繰り返し行われ、同ファイルを上書きします。
なぜこんなもの作ったのかと言いますと、普段使っている目覚ましアプリがメディアファイルのランダム指定に対応していないからです。目覚ましアプリの音源にランダム化されたファイルを指定すれば、毎日違う音で目覚ましが鳴るので、新鮮な気持ちで目が覚めます。
必要になる度に直接ファイルにアクセスするタイプのアプリなら、画像でも音声でも毎日ランダムにできます。
(世の中には、設定が行われたら自アプリ領域にファイルをコピーするタイプのアプリもあると思うので、その場合は使えません)
(Android4.4の標準時計アプリのアラームの場合、oggファイルをAlarmsフォルダに並べて、当アプリでAlarmsフォルダを指定してランダム化すれば対応可能でした)
保存先については、外部SDカード対応とAlarmsフォルダ対応の兼ね合いで、専用フォルダか対象フォルダの2択になっています。
具体的に言うと、
・標準時計アプリのためにAlarmsにファイルを置いた場合に、「対象フォルダに保存する」をチェックしてランダム化すると、アラーム音選択時に「randomized」が選択できると思います。
・Android4.4以上の機種で、対象フォルダに外部SDカードを指定する場合に、「対象フォルダに保存する」をチェックしてランダム化すると、必ず処理失敗しますのでチェックしないでください。これはAndroidの仕様です。
ランダム化間隔の変更だとかフォルダ名/ファイル名の変更だとかの機能は付けてないですが、対象フォルダの再帰的検索(対象フォルダ内に更にフォルダがある場合に、その内部のファイルもランダム化の対象にする)のON/OFFができます。
外的要因でランダム化できなかった場合は(指定フォルダがなくなってたりだとか)、通知を出して毎日の処理を止めるので確認してください。
すごくニッチな自覚はあるので、意見/要望/質問等頂ければ可能な限りで対応します。
</div> <div jsname="WJz9Hc" style="display:none">在该文件夹中具有一个特定的分机的多个文件,它是一个应用程序,以取代固定的文件的内容随意。
例如,要指定一个包含了很多的MP3文件,您可以指定MP3到你把交换机扩展的文件夹。
然后你选择并从MP3文件复制一个随机指定的文件夹中,您可以在用户内存直接创建一个“随机”的文件夹,并保存为“randomized.mp3”(可以改变)。重复这一过程,在多午夜每天一次,我将覆盖相同的文件。
为什么我说是什么让这几样东西,因为有您使用通常不对应的随机指定的媒体文件的应用程序报警。如果指定的应用程序报警随机文件中的声音源,因为不同的声音每天在闹钟响起,你有耳目一新的感觉中醒来。
你可以很容易地找到你想要直接访问它所需的文件时应用的类型,你可以每天随机图像甚至语音。
(这个世界,因为我觉得设置也是要将该文件复制到自己的应用领域。当你完成的应用程序类型,则不能使用此情况下)
(在Android4.4的标准时钟的应用程序,并排奥格文件到警报夹报警的情况下,这是可能的,以对应如果随机指定在该应用中,警报夹)
对于目标,在考虑外部支持SD卡和报警文件夹支持,它已成为一个双选择专用文件夹或目标文件夹中。
具体而言,
•如果将文件的时候随机检查“保存的目标文件夹”警报标准时钟程序,我想“随机”,可以在报警声选择的时间选择。
·Android4.4以上机型,如果你要指定一个外置SD卡到目标文件夹,随机检查“保存的目标文件夹”,请不要检查,因为你总是处理故障。这是Android的设计。
十日的文件夹名/文件名的时间间隔的变化十日的变化是随机化功能不显着,但如果有更多的文件夹递归搜索(目标文件夹中的目标文件夹,还随机其内部文件我可以在/到目标OFF)。
如果您无法在随机外部因素(如它还是走了指定的文件夹),请检查因此通过发放通知停止日常过程。
由于存在非常小众意识,它会在尽可能如果意见/需求/问题得到解决。</div> <div class="show-more-end">